Output d3678897fe221eef2158b7f577c209aae54a486388f2da2fae6aae505c360372:0

value
188054557
script pubkey
OP_0 OP_PUSHBYTES_20 27a5930e2f32b32be03c65b9f708a656a7fda122
address
ltc1qy7jexr30x2ejhcpuvkulwz9x26nlmgfzhralxv
transaction
d3678897fe221eef2158b7f577c209aae54a486388f2da2fae6aae505c360372
spent
true